Hmm... jungling in TT is the same as jungling in SR in its core concepts: balancing farming, ganking and invading. The differences is that due to a smaller map size (and layout), the effect of team coordination/timing and champs with good sustain is more evident.
For example, if you have a jungler with strong sustain and invade, then you want your lanes to push out early so they can support the invade. Also, anytime we run into a team that jungles without smite, our jungler can invade with impunity cuz of level and hp difference.
Of course, if you have solid coordination and took 3ignite3exhaust, then you *could* try and counter any invades by straight up all in-ing.
But then the other team could just fast clear, heal and then invade after taking their altar at full hp.
